Something about the upcoming fall season makes me want to bring out my slow cooker! This slow cooked chicken is juicy and tender, and well seasoned so it’s great for a weeknight dinner or you can easily use it for meal prep for the week! 🍽️

  • 13oz (2 thighs) b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s
  • 22oz (4 drumsticks) chicken drumsticks
  • 2 tsp salt
  • 2 tsp pepper
  • 2 tsp garlic powder
  • 2 tsp onion powder
  • 2 tsp paprika
  • 2 tsp cayenne pepper
  • 2 tsp italian seasoning
  • 2 tsp minced garlic
  • ½ onion
  • 5 garlic cloves 
  • Calories: 530 cals
  • Protein: 59 g
  • Carbs: 5 g
  • Fat: 29 g

Per piece of chicken:

  • 1 thigh: 250 cals, 17g protein, 0g carbs, 15g fat
  • 1 drumstick : 150 cals, 21g protein, 0g carbs, 7g fat
  1. Prep the chicken: Wash and trim chicken. Place the pieces flat in your slow cooker so they’re not stacked.
  2. Season generously: Sprinkle 1 tsp of each seasoning over one side of the chicken, flip, and season the other side with the remaining 1 tsp. (Optional: add an extra dash of each spice if you love bold flavor.) Add the minced garlic on top.

  1. Cook: Cover and cook on high for 4–5 hours, flipping the chicken every hour.
  2. Add aromatics: In the final hour of cooking, add sliced onion and whole garlic cloves.

  1. Serve & enjoy: Pair with mashed potatoes, rice, quinoa, or your favorite side dish.
